"Your Memory: How It Works and How to Improve It" is a book written by Kenneth L. Higbee, a psychologist and memory expert. First published in 1977 and later updated in subsequent editions, the book serves as a comprehensive guide to understanding the mechanisms of human memory and provides practical techniques for improving memory function.
Higbee explores various aspects of memory, including short-term memory, long-term memory, and the processes involved in encoding, storing, and retrieving information. He discusses common memory problems and misconceptions, such as forgetting names or misplacing items, and offers strategies for overcoming these challenges.
The book offers a range of memory improvement techniques, from simple mnemonic devices and visualization exercises to more advanced memory training methods. Higbee emphasizes the importance of practice, organization, and attention to detail in enhancing memory performance.
